Three polaroid sheets $P_1$, $P_2$, and $P_3$ are kept parallel to each other such that the angle between the polarization axes of $P_1$ and $P_2$ is $45^\circ$, and that between $P_2$ and $P_3$ is $45^\circ$. If an unpolarized beam of light with an intensity of $128 \, \text{Wm}^{-2}$ is incident on $P_1$, what is the intensity of light coming out of $P_3$?

$64 \, \text{Wm}^{-2}$

$128 \, \text{Wm}^{-2}$

$0$

$16 \, \text{Wm}^{-2}$
